Aspen

Scientific name : Populus tremula

Short Description

Deciduous, up to 30 m high tree with thin, roundish wide overhanging crown on straight stem, bark initially grey with characteristic lenticels stripes (corkpores), later black grey and long fissured, but hardly furrowed or fielded; Alternate leaves, long stalked, of ...
